We are seeking an experienced Administration Manager to support our Melbourne operations from our Glen Iris office. This role provides high‑level administrative support to the State Manager and wider business, ensuring smooth day‑to‑day operations, strong internal communication, and full compliance with our management systems. You will also oversee 1–2 administration staff, guiding their workflow and ensuring consistent quality across all administrative functions.
THE ROLE
- Coordinate day‑to‑day administrative operations, ensuring efficient workflow and effective management of overheads and resources.
- Maintain and support the organisation’s Management System, ensuring accuracy, compliance, and timely updates.
- Provide high‑level administrative support to the State Manager and broader team, including reporting, data collation, and document preparation.
- Lead and oversee 1–2 administration staff, allocating tasks and maintaining consistent communication across the office.
- Manage stock levels, conduct stock takes, and ensure all processes meet compliance requirements.
- Present a professional and courteous image to internal and external stakeholders while handling general office duties such as data entry, filing, and archiving.
ABOUT YOU
- Minimum 5 years’ experience in a senior administration or coordinator role, ideally supporting management.
- Proven ability to manage overheads, resources, and administrative workflows.
- Advanced skills in Microsoft Excel and Word, with strong capability in reporting and document management.
- Exceptional attention to detail, including formatting, editing, copywriting, and proof‑reading.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to convey information clearly and professionally.
- Proactive, organised, and able to anticipate needs in a fast‑paced environment.
- Strong team player with the ability to multitask, prioritise, and meet competing deadlines.

ABOUT US
The Duratec group of Companies is an ASX listed, solutions–driven business specialising in the protection, remediation, and enhancement of steel and concrete structures. We provide whole-of -life engineering, construction, and maintenance services with a Company focus on sustainably extending the life of the built environment. We’ve been around since 2010 giving us solid foundations and we’re currently on an exciting trajectory of growth.
Operating across Australia we work on projects in Defence, mining, energy, marine, infrastructure, and building and facades. Our reputation for collaboration and successful project delivery has resulted in Australia-wide expansion of the business and we’re dedicated to forming new branches across Australasia.
We have a workforce of approximately 1,200 people across 19 locations spanning every State and Territory in Australia. We have an exciting future ahead and it’s a great time to join the team!
